Which Books Written By James Michener Became Movies?

3 Answers2025-06-04 09:45:49
James Michener's epic storytelling has inspired several film adaptations, and one of the most famous is 'Hawaii,' a sweeping tale of missionaries and native culture that became a 1966 movie starring Julie Andrews. Another standout is 'South Pacific,' based on his Pulitzer-winning 'Tales of the South Pacific,' which was adapted into a beloved musical film in 1958. I’ve always been fascinated by how his dense historical novels translate to the screen, and 'The Bridges at Toko-Ri' is another great example—a gripping Korean War story that became a 1954 film with William Holden. Michener’s knack for vivid settings and deep character arcs makes his works perfect for cinematic retellings, even if they often get condensed for runtime.

Who Does Bathsheba Everdene Marry In 'Far From The Madding Crowd'?

4 Answers2025-06-20 15:59:57
Bathsheba Everdene’s journey in 'Far From the Madding Crowd' is a tumultuous dance of love and independence. She initially marries Sergeant Francis Troy, a dashing but reckless soldier whose charm masks his instability. Their union is fiery and disastrous, marked by Troy’s gambling and infidelity. After his apparent death, Bathsheba eventually finds solace in Gabriel Oak, her steadfast shepherd whose quiet devotion contrasts Troy’s volatility. Oak’s unwavering loyalty and practical wisdom finally win her heart, offering the stability she unknowingly craved. Their marriage symbolizes growth—Bathsheba shedding vanity for maturity, and Oak’s patience rewarded. The novel’s romantic arcs dissect class and character: Troy represents impulsive passion, Boldwood obsessive fixation, and Oak enduring love. Hardy’s ending affirms that true partnership thrives beyond fleeting sparks, rooted in mutual respect.

What Happens At The Ending Of Girls In Pants: The Third Summer Of The Sisterhood?

2 Answers2026-02-26 05:14:10
The ending of 'Girls in Pants: The Third Summer of the Sisterhood' wraps up another emotional and transformative summer for the four friends. Lena finally confronts her feelings for Kostos, realizing that their connection is deeper than she allowed herself to admit. After a lot of back-and-forth, they share a heartfelt moment where she acknowledges her love for him, even if their future remains uncertain. Meanwhile, Carmen steps up as a support system for her mother, who’s pregnant and navigating a new relationship. It’s a turning point for Carmen, who learns to embrace change rather than resist it. Tibby, ever the skeptic, finds herself opening up to Brian in a way she never expected, and their relationship takes a sweet, tentative step forward. Bridget’s storyline is particularly poignant—she reconnects with Eric, but more importantly, she begins to heal from the grief of her mother’s death, finally allowing herself to fully process her emotions. The book closes with the girls reaffirming their bond, pants and all, ready to face whatever comes next together. What I love about this ending is how it balances closure with open-ended possibilities. Each character’s arc feels organic, and the friendships remain the heart of the story. Lena’s artistic growth, Carmen’s maturity, Tibby’s vulnerability, and Bridget’s healing—they all feel earned. The pants, symbolic of their unity, are still there, but the girls are undeniably changed by the summer. It’s a testament to Ann Brashares’ ability to write coming-of-age stories that resonate. The ending doesn’t tie everything up with a neat bow, but it leaves you satisfied, like a good conversation with old friends.

Who Wrote Midnight Memories 1d Lyrics And What Inspired Them?

4 Answers2025-08-24 02:15:51
I still get a little giddy when that opening guitar riff of 'Midnight Memories' kicks in. To break it down plainly: the title track from One Direction’s 2013 album was written by a mix of the band and their regular collaborators — the five members (Harry Styles, Liam Payne, Louis Tomlinson, Niall Horan and Zayn Malik) worked on it alongside Jamie Scott, Julian Bunetta and John Ryan. Julian Bunetta and John Ryan were also key in producing and shaping the song’s sound. What inspired the lyrics? It’s basically a snapshot of life on the road and the reckless, late-night energy that comes with being young and touring non-stop. The band wanted a grittier, more rock-leaning anthem than their earlier bubblegum pop — think late nights, city lights, and making memories that feel important at the moment. Interviews around the album talked about wanting a rawer, more band-oriented vibe, so the lyrics match that: a celebration of impulsive youth and the kind of memories you tell stories about later. Whenever I hear it, I picture sweaty venues, buses at 3 a.m., and a group of friends laughing about something that felt huge then — that’s the spirit behind it.
